enum RelocationInfoType

Declared at: llvm/include/llvm/BinaryFormat/MachO.h:399

Enumerators

NameValueComment
GENERIC_RELOC_INVALID255
GENERIC_RELOC_VANILLA0
GENERIC_RELOC_PAIR1
GENERIC_RELOC_SECTDIFF2
GENERIC_RELOC_PB_LA_PTR3
GENERIC_RELOC_LOCAL_SECTDIFF4
GENERIC_RELOC_TLV5
PPC_RELOC_VANILLA0
PPC_RELOC_PAIR1
PPC_RELOC_BR142
PPC_RELOC_BR243
PPC_RELOC_HI164
PPC_RELOC_LO165
PPC_RELOC_HA166
PPC_RELOC_LO147
PPC_RELOC_SECTDIFF8
PPC_RELOC_PB_LA_PTR9
PPC_RELOC_HI16_SECTDIFF10
PPC_RELOC_LO16_SECTDIFF11
PPC_RELOC_HA16_SECTDIFF12
PPC_RELOC_JBSR13
PPC_RELOC_LO14_SECTDIFF14
PPC_RELOC_LOCAL_SECTDIFF15
ARM_RELOC_VANILLA0
ARM_RELOC_PAIR1
ARM_RELOC_SECTDIFF2
ARM_RELOC_LOCAL_SECTDIFF3
ARM_RELOC_PB_LA_PTR4
ARM_RELOC_BR245
ARM_THUMB_RELOC_BR226
ARM_THUMB_32BIT_BRANCH7
ARM_RELOC_HALF8
ARM_RELOC_HALF_SECTDIFF9
ARM64_RELOC_UNSIGNED0
ARM64_RELOC_SUBTRACTOR1
ARM64_RELOC_BRANCH262
ARM64_RELOC_PAGE213
ARM64_RELOC_PAGEOFF124
ARM64_RELOC_GOT_LOAD_PAGE215
ARM64_RELOC_GOT_LOAD_PAGEOFF126
ARM64_RELOC_POINTER_TO_GOT7
ARM64_RELOC_TLVP_LOAD_PAGE218
ARM64_RELOC_TLVP_LOAD_PAGEOFF129
ARM64_RELOC_ADDEND10
X86_64_RELOC_UNSIGNED0
X86_64_RELOC_SIGNED1
X86_64_RELOC_BRANCH2
X86_64_RELOC_GOT_LOAD3
X86_64_RELOC_GOT4
X86_64_RELOC_SUBTRACTOR5
X86_64_RELOC_SIGNED_16
X86_64_RELOC_SIGNED_27
X86_64_RELOC_SIGNED_48
X86_64_RELOC_TLV9